Bio

Alana de la Garza is an American actress best known for her role as A.D.A. Connie Rubirosa in Law & Order, from 2006-2010. She reprised her role as Connie Rubirosa in Law & Order: LA in 2011.

She was previously known for her role as Maria Serrano in The Mountain, from 2004-2005.

De la Garza was born in Columbus, Ohio, and raised in El Paso, Texas. She attended the University of Texas and then moved to New York City to study acting at The School for Film & Television.

Following her training in New York, de la Garza moved to Los Angeles to pursue her dream of acting. She has also modelled for print and commercial campaigns.

De la Garza stars in El Segundo, a feature that was screened at the 2004 Cine Las Americas Film Festival. The actress can also be seen in the independent romantic comedy film The Perfect Lie, opposite David Boreanaz.

She's starred in the short film Mr.Dramatic, as Mrs. Dramatic alongside The Mountain's Oliver Hudson, and appears in the feature Carnival Knowledge.

Her additional credits include guest-starring roles in the Tv shows Las Vegas, Two and a Half Men and JAG. She also starred as Rosa Santos on the daytime soapie All My Children.

In 2016 she began starring in the CBS police procedural series Criminal Minds: Beyond Borders, as a linguistics expert.
